In its March 2024 market overview, MyMarketPulse (mymarketpulse.com) highlights the real estate dynamics within King and Queen County, Virginia.
As of 3/2024, King and Queen County had a Median Sale Price of $264,950, which was down 22.9% from the previous month and up 15.4% from the prior year.
4 homes were sold, unchanged from the previous month and unchanged from the prior year.
Furthermore, homes in King and Queen County were on the market for an average of 16 days before selling, reflecting an increase of 8 days days month-over-month and a decrease of 95 days day year-over-year.
With a Market Pulse Score of 96, the analysis suggests a falling trend in King and Queen County’s housing market momentum.
